Vasseur balks after qualifying in Qatar: 'Didn't come as a surprise'

While Ferrari did very well in Monza and in Singapore, and was also just one place off a podium in Japan, the team seems to be having problems in Qatar. Carlos Sainz was eliminated in Q2 already, and Charles Leclerc finished in fifth place, after the times of both Lando Norris and Oscar Piastri were taken down by track limits. Ferrari team boss Frederic Vasseur spoke about his team's result after qualifying.
